Key: ZOOKEEPER-780 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/ZOOKEEPER-780 Project: Zookeeper Issue Type: Bug Components: scripts Affects Versions: 3.3.1 Environment: Linux Ubuntu running in VMPlayer on top of Windows XP Reporter: Miguel Correia Priority: Minor I'm starting to play with Zookeeper so I'm still running it in standalone mode. This is not a big issue, but here it goes for the records. I've run zkCli.sh to run some commands in the server. I created a znode /groups. When I tried to create a znode client_1 inside /groups, I forgot to include the data: an exception was generated and zkCli-sh crashed, instead of just showing an error. I tried a few variations and it seems like the problem is not including the data. A copy of the screen: [zk: localhost:2181(CONNECTED) 3] create /groups firstgroup Created /groups [zk: localhost:2181(CONNECTED) 4] create -e /groups/client_1 Exception in thread "main" java.lang.ArrayIndexOutOfBoundsException: 3 at org.apache.zookeeper.ZooKeeperMain.processZKCmd(ZooKeeperMain.java:678) at org.apache.zookeeper.ZooKeeperMain.processCmd(ZooKeeperMain.java:581) at org.apache.zookeeper.ZooKeeperMain.executeLine(ZooKeeperMain.java:353) at org.apache.zookeeper.ZooKeeperMain.run(ZooKeeperMain.java:311) at org.apache.zookeeper.ZooKeeperMain.main(ZooKeeperMain.java:270) -- This message is automatically generated by JIRA. - You can reply to this email to add a comment to the issue online.
